Almond Objective Report Includes Low Carryout
The 2024 California Almond Objective Measurement Report published Wednesday by the U.S. Department of Agriculture’s National Agricultural Statistics Service (USDA-NASS) estimates that the crop harvested in 2024 will come in at 2.80 billion meat pounds.The estimate is down 7 percent from USDA-NASS’s Subjective Forecast in May. It follows a generally solid bloom as well as a year in which growers faced a range of economic challenges. It also comes when the carryout is projected to drop to levels not seen in years as almond shipments set a record of 10 months straight of at least 212 million pounds shipped.
